1. Material Selection for Classroom Furniture

First, many people are confused about the choice of materials for classroom furniture. Wood, plastic, or metal? This is a real problem! Wooden furniture looks warm but may not be wear-resistant; plastic furniture is lightweight and easy to clean, but its lifespan is relatively short; metal furniture is sturdy and durable, suitable for long-term use. The choice can be made based on the usage environment and budget.

2. Size and Space Layout

Secondly, the classroom's space layout and furniture size are also essential factors. A small classroom with too much furniture may lead to cramped space, affecting students' activities. Conversely, oversized furniture will make the classroom look empty. Therefore, measuring the classroom area and rationally planning the furniture size can make the classroom more welcoming.

3. Functionality of Classroom Furniture

Furthermore, the functionality of classroom furniture is a key factor we need to consider. For example, adjustable-height desks and chairs can accommodate students of different heights, while foldable furniture can save space and facilitate storage. When choosing furniture, it is necessary to consider its practicality and multi-functionality to ensure that each piece of furniture can maximize its effectiveness.

4. Safety of Classroom Furniture

Safety is an aspect of classroom furniture that cannot be ignored. Sharp corners and loose parts can pose potential dangers to children. Therefore, when choosing furniture, pay special attention to these details to ensure that it meets safety standards and avoids adding hidden dangers to children's learning and life.

5. Budget and Value for Money

Finally, the budget is a common concern. The prices of classroom furniture vary greatly. How can we choose cost-effective furniture within a limited budget? It is recommended to compare products from several suppliers, looking at their materials, design, and prices, and making a rational choice based on actual needs.
